The rent is €1,300 per month, which is 20% below the neighbourhood average of €1,617, a keen price compared to other rental homes in Gooise Meren.
Based on one review, the neighbourhood Brinklaan scores a 7.25. One resident says: "Right in the centre so plenty to do. Also everything is within walking distance, which makes it ideal to live." The area is densely built-up with mostly flats (87% of homes) and a young population, over a third of residents are between 25 and 45. Many live alone, and average incomes are around the national norm.
For daily shopping, Nettorama is on your doorstep, Ekoplaza is just around the corner, and Albert Heijn is a five-minute walk. The Katholieke Basisschool Sint Vitus is a couple of streets away, and the Goois Lyceum secondary school is a ten-minute walk. The municipality Gooise Meren offers plenty of restaurants and a library within walking distance.

The rent is €1,300 per month, which is 20% below the average rent in the Brinklaan neighbourhood (€1,617). Without knowing the floor area or property type, it is hard to compare on a per-square-metre basis, but the price is on the low side for the area.
Brinklaan is a very urban area in the centre of Bussum, with a high density of addresses. It has a young population, many single-person households, and a mix of shops and restaurants within walking distance. One resident describes it as having plenty to do and everything within walking distance.
The nearest train station is 1.1 km away, which is about a ten-minute walk.
Nettorama is 108 metres away, Ekoplaza is 205 metres, and Albert Heijn is 366 metres. All are within a short walk.
Yes, the Katholieke Basisschool Sint Vitus is 211 metres away, and the Goois Lyceum secondary school is 693 metres away. Several other primary and secondary schools are within a kilometre.
